Littlefield is a city in West Texas in the United States.
The town is the administrative seat of Lamb County. The surrounding region is strongly influenced by the cultivation of cotton, a large denim factory is located in Littlefield.
Littlefield is the birthplace of country stars Waylon Jennings, who invented the apt characterization of Littlefield as " suburb of a cotton patch".
